Fisher vs. DeVry College of New York

Both St. John Fisher University and DeVry College of New York are 4 years schools located in New York. The following statements compare St. John Fisher University and DeVry College of New York with important academic statistics including tuition, test scores, and admission rate.
  • Both schools are private.
  • Fisher's tuition ($41,190) is more expensive than DeVry College of New York ($17,008).
  • Fisher's acceptance rate (66.40%) is lower than DeVry College of New York (100.00%).
  • DeVry College of New York has higher yield (50.00%) than Fisher (20.28%).
  • Both schools have same SAT scores of 1,210.
  • DeVry College of New York's students to faculty ratio (3 to 1) is lower than Fisher (11 to 1).
  • Fisher (3,693 students) is larger than DeVry College of New York (107 students) with more enrolled students.
  • Fisher ($22,380) has higher amount of financial aid than DeVry College of New York ($5,759).
  • Fisher's graduation rate (74%) is higher than DeVry College of New York (31%).
